Abstract

The invention provides a full-spatial-domain attitude feedback system which comprises a display, a remote controller body, a vibration motor, a sound player and a control circuit. The display is fixedly arranged on the remote controller body, and used to display a simulated interface of a flight meter panel; the remote controller body is provided with remote-control peripheral equipment for receiving a user remote control instruction; the vibration motor is accommodated in the remote controller body and used to generate vibration of the remote controller body; the sound player is arranged on the remote controller body and used to output audio signals; the control circuit is accommodated in the remote controller body, and connected with the display, the vibration motor, a lamp group and thesound player; and the control circuit controls the display, vibration motor and sound player according to the operation state of a model aircraft, and back feeds corresponding attitude information toa user.

technical field [0001] The present application relates to the technical field of remote control models, in particular to a whole airspace attitude feedback system. Background technique [0002] With the continuous development of VR and other image technologies, people have higher and higher requirements for the simulation of aircraft model aircraft. How to provide aeromodelling with a good degree of simulation and make the user feel personally on the scene is a hot issue in the field of remote control models. [0003] The fidelity of existing remote control models usually focuses on remote control objects (such as model aircraft helicopters). The production of these remote control objects is getting better and better, and some of them are equipped with speakers, which can output corresponding engine sound waves, so that the simulation effect of the model aircraft is better, and it has an operation or riding experience similar to that of a real aircraft.
